Commercial decorators play a crucial role in creating inspiring, functional, and visually appealing spaces that leave a lasting impression. Whether it's a modern office, a chic retail store, or a welcoming restaurant, expert decorators can elevate the ambiance to match the brand's vision and values. Their expertise ensures that every detail, from the color palette to the furniture arrangement, aligns perfectly with the intended aesthetic and purpose.
A strong emphasis is placed on understanding the unique needs of each business. By collaborating closely with clients, decorators gain insights into the brand's personality and target audience. This approach allows them to craft spaces that not only look stunning but also foster productivity, customer engagement, or relaxation, depending on the environment's purpose.
Functionality is just as critical as aesthetics in commercial decorating. Spaces are designed to maximize usability while maintaining a sense of style. For example, an office may feature ergonomic furniture and efficient layouts that enhance workflow, while a retail store might prioritize strategic lighting and displays to boost sales.
The choice of materials and finishes often reflects the durability required for high-traffic areas. Designers are skilled in selecting fabrics, flooring, and wall treatments that stand the test of time while maintaining visual appeal. This careful selection ensures that the investment in decor delivers long-term value.
Lighting is another crucial aspect of commercial decorating. The right lighting scheme can create a mood, highlight key areas, or enhance the overall atmosphere of the space. Designers often use a mix of natural and artificial lighting to achieve a balanced and dynamic environment.
Sustainability has become a key focus in modern commercial decorating. Many businesses now seek eco-friendly solutions, and decorators are adept at incorporating sustainable materials and energy-efficient designs into their projects. These choices not only benefit the environment but also appeal to eco-conscious clients and customers.
Ultimately, professional commercial decorators bring a combination of creativity, technical knowledge, and industry expertise to every project. Their ability to transform ordinary spaces into extraordinary environments can have a profound impact on a business's success. From concept to execution, the process is tailored to deliver results that captivate and inspire.
